public interface InternalKeys
| Modifier and Type | Field and Description |
|---|---|
static String |
CHAOS_MONKEY_DELAY |
static String |
CHAOS_MONKEY_DELAY_DAYS |
static String |
CHAOS_MONKEY_DELAY_HOURS |
static String |
CHAOS_MONKEY_DELAY_MINUTES |
static String |
CHAOS_MONKEY_DELAY_SECONDS |
static String |
CHAOS_MONKEY_ENABLED
Flag to indicate whether or not the chaos monkey is enabled:
"internal.chaos.monkey.enabled"
|
static String |
CHAOS_MONKEY_INTERVAL
Rate
|
static String |
CHAOS_MONKEY_INTERVAL_DAYS |
static String |
CHAOS_MONKEY_INTERVAL_HOURS |
static String |
CHAOS_MONKEY_INTERVAL_MINUTES |
static String |
CHAOS_MONKEY_INTERVAL_SECONDS |
static String |
CHAOS_MONKEY_PROBABILITY
Prefix for all chaos monkey probabilities
|
static String |
CHAOS_MONKEY_PROBABILITY_AM_FAILURE
Probability of a monkey check killing the AM: "internal.chaos.monkey.probability.amfailure"
|
static String |
CHAOS_MONKEY_PROBABILITY_AM_LAUNCH_FAILURE
Probability of a monkey check killing the AM: "internal.chaos.monkey.probability.amlaunchfailure"
|
static String |
CHAOS_MONKEY_PROBABILITY_CONTAINER_FAILURE
Probability of a monkey check killing a container: "internal.chaos.monkey.probability.containerfailure"
|
static boolean |
DEFAULT_CHAOS_MONKEY_ENABLED |
static int |
DEFAULT_CHAOS_MONKEY_INTERVAL_DAYS |
static int |
DEFAULT_CHAOS_MONKEY_INTERVAL_HOURS |
static int |
DEFAULT_CHAOS_MONKEY_INTERVAL_MINUTES |
static int |
DEFAULT_CHAOS_MONKEY_PROBABILITY_AM_FAILURE
Default probability of a monkey check killing the AM: 0
|
static int |
DEFAULT_CHAOS_MONKEY_PROBABILITY_CONTAINER_FAILURE
Default probability of a monkey check killing the a container: 0
|
static int |
DEFAULT_CHAOS_MONKEY_STARTUP_DELAY |
static int |
DEFAULT_ESCALATION_CHECK_INTERVAL
default value: 30
|
static int |
DEFAULT_INTERNAL_CONTAINER_FAILURE_SHORTLIFE
Default short life threshold: 60
|
static int |
DEFAULT_INTERNAL_CONTAINER_STARTUP_DELAY
Time in milliseconds to wait after forking any in-AM
process before attempting to start up the containers: 5000
A shorter value brings the cluster up faster, but means that if the
in AM process fails (due to a bad configuration), then time
is wasted starting containers on a cluster that isn't going to come
up
|
static String |
ESCALATION_CHECK_INTERVAL
interval between checks for escalation: "escalation.check.interval.seconds"
|
static String |
INTERNAL_ADDONS_DIR_PATH
where addons for the app are stored
|
static String |
INTERNAL_AM_TMP_DIR
internal temp directory: "internal.am.tmp.dir"
|
static String |
INTERNAL_APPDEF_DIR_PATH
where the app def is stored
|
static String |
INTERNAL_APPLICATION_HOME
Home dir of the app: "internal.application.home"
If set, implies there is a home dir to use
|
static String |
INTERNAL_APPLICATION_IMAGE_PATH
Path to an image file containing the app: "internal.application.image.path"
|
static String |
INTERNAL_CONTAINER_FAILURE_SHORTLIFE
Time in seconds before a container is considered long-lived.
|
static String |
INTERNAL_CONTAINER_STARTUP_DELAY
Time in milliseconds to wait after forking any in-AM
process before attempting to start up the containers: "internal.container.startup.delay"
A shorter value brings the cluster up faster, but means that if the
in AM process fails (due to a bad configuration), then time
is wasted starting containers on a cluster that isn't going to come
up
|
static String |
INTERNAL_DATA_DIR_PATH
where a snapshot of the original conf dir is: "internal.data.dir.path"
|
static String |
INTERNAL_GENERATED_CONF_PATH
where a snapshot of the original conf dir is: "internal.generated.conf.path"
|
static String |
INTERNAL_PROVIDER_NAME
where a snapshot of the original conf dir is: "internal.provider.name"
|
static String |
INTERNAL_QUEUE
Queue used to deploy the app: "internal.queue"
|
static String |
INTERNAL_SNAPSHOT_CONF_PATH
where a snapshot of the original conf dir is: "internal.snapshot.conf.path"
|
static String |
INTERNAL_TMP_DIR
internal temp directory: "internal.tmp.dir"
|
static String |
KEYTAB_LOCATION
Version of the app: "internal.keytab.location"
|
static int |
PROBABILITY_PERCENT_1
1% of chaos
|
static int |
PROBABILITY_PERCENT_100
100% for chaos values
|
static final String INTERNAL_APPLICATION_HOME
static final String INTERNAL_APPLICATION_IMAGE_PATH
static final String INTERNAL_CONTAINER_STARTUP_DELAY
static final String INTERNAL_AM_TMP_DIR
static final String INTERNAL_TMP_DIR
static final String INTERNAL_SNAPSHOT_CONF_PATH
static final String INTERNAL_GENERATED_CONF_PATH
static final String INTERNAL_PROVIDER_NAME
static final String INTERNAL_DATA_DIR_PATH
static final String INTERNAL_APPDEF_DIR_PATH
static final String INTERNAL_ADDONS_DIR_PATH
static final int DEFAULT_INTERNAL_CONTAINER_STARTUP_DELAY
static final String INTERNAL_CONTAINER_FAILURE_SHORTLIFE
static final int DEFAULT_INTERNAL_CONTAINER_FAILURE_SHORTLIFE
static final String KEYTAB_LOCATION
static final String INTERNAL_QUEUE
static final String CHAOS_MONKEY_ENABLED
static final boolean DEFAULT_CHAOS_MONKEY_ENABLED
static final String CHAOS_MONKEY_INTERVAL
static final String CHAOS_MONKEY_INTERVAL_DAYS
static final String CHAOS_MONKEY_INTERVAL_HOURS
static final String CHAOS_MONKEY_INTERVAL_MINUTES
static final String CHAOS_MONKEY_INTERVAL_SECONDS
static final int DEFAULT_CHAOS_MONKEY_INTERVAL_DAYS
static final int DEFAULT_CHAOS_MONKEY_INTERVAL_HOURS
static final int DEFAULT_CHAOS_MONKEY_INTERVAL_MINUTES
static final String CHAOS_MONKEY_DELAY
static final String CHAOS_MONKEY_DELAY_DAYS
static final String CHAOS_MONKEY_DELAY_HOURS
static final String CHAOS_MONKEY_DELAY_MINUTES
static final String CHAOS_MONKEY_DELAY_SECONDS
static final int DEFAULT_CHAOS_MONKEY_STARTUP_DELAY
static final String CHAOS_MONKEY_PROBABILITY
static final String CHAOS_MONKEY_PROBABILITY_AM_FAILURE
static final int DEFAULT_CHAOS_MONKEY_PROBABILITY_AM_FAILURE
static final String CHAOS_MONKEY_PROBABILITY_AM_LAUNCH_FAILURE
static final String CHAOS_MONKEY_PROBABILITY_CONTAINER_FAILURE
static final int DEFAULT_CHAOS_MONKEY_PROBABILITY_CONTAINER_FAILURE
static final int PROBABILITY_PERCENT_1
static final int PROBABILITY_PERCENT_100
static final String ESCALATION_CHECK_INTERVAL
static final int DEFAULT_ESCALATION_CHECK_INTERVAL
Copyright © 2014–2015 The Apache Software Foundation. All rights reserved.